Uudelleenmetsittämistä
Uudelleenmetsittäminen, or reforestation, is the process of replanting trees in areas where forests have been depleted. This can be done through natural regeneration, where seeds from nearby forests spread and grow, or through active planting, where humans sow seeds or plant saplings. The primary drivers for reforestation are the degradation of forest ecosystems due to deforestation, logging, wildfires, or agricultural expansion.
